A brand new CO detector fitted in March 2017, was defective from the time it was fitted.
I had a new gas boiler fitted in March by British Gas, who also supplied a Honeywell CO (carbon monoxide) detector, BG, of course, left no instructions with it, and from day one we were plagued by this detector giving off 2 loud whistles, within a few seconds of each other, every few minutes.
Complained to BG, who rushed around after 3 weeks!!, and said it was the detector, and change it in March next year AND THAT WAS IT, I stuck this out until the other day, when after hunting high and low finally found a Honeywell web site, I emailed them with the details, and SF450EN detector, and they came back with WE HAVE NO TRACE OF THIS, sound typical!!!, and redirected me to a phone line, and website. Of course the phone didn't work, it was discontinued, and so I emailed the web site, so far nothing except an email that said, we see that the trouble has been resolved, OH NO IT HASN'T'.
What a performance form a so called international firm.
I took the detector down to throw it away, as I had ordered a KIDDE one, and on the inside of the lid it said, 2 CHIRPS PER MINUTE :DETECTOR FAULT!!!!!!!
That means that from the time it was fitted it has been defective, I emailed them and said I want a replacement under guarantee, or I,d rather have the money back, since I had ordered a new one from a different firm,.
GUESS WHAT THEY HAVN'T REPLIED
Now the 25th November, and according to Honeywell, a technical advisor will be in touch, they didn,t say what year though, quite frankly I am disgusted with ALL big firms, they hide behind non existent phone and web sites, and just take your money.
